The Online Farming Route System is
designed to optimize the agricultural logistics and
routing system, providing farmers and transporters with
efficient routes for delivering farm produce to markets
and processing centers. This system addresses critical
issues in agricultural supply chains, such as inefficient
route management, time delays, and increased costs due
to poorly planned logistics. By incorporating advanced
algorithms for route optimization and real-time data
analytics, the system ensures that farm products reach
their destinations in a timely and cost-effective manner.
The system leverages geographic information system
(GIS) technology to calculate optimal routes, taking
into account factors such as road conditions, weather,
traffic, and delivery time windows. The proposed system
aims to support small-scale farmers and improve their
market access, ensuring higher profitability and
minimizing losses. The Online Farming Route System is
